Using Color Schemes

Download Report

Transcript Using Color Schemes

The GLOWA Volta Geoportal

an interactive geodata repository and information system

Dr. Serge Shumilov, Joscha Laubach Department of Computer Science III Antonio Rogmann, Peter Wittkötter Center for Development Research (ZEF)

University of Bonn

What is Geoportal?

Geoportal is a Web-based information system providing:

Easy interactive remote access to the GLOWA Volta data service

Cataloguing and management of heterogeneous datasets Internet

Web Browser

Web server HTTP

WMS Client

JDBC Data server Data catalog

Services to publish, access and share data over the internet

Tools for interactive search, visualization and analysis of data Intranet Geoportal HTTP SMB / NFS SMB Data storage

WMS Client Web Browser ESRI ArcGIS Client

Antonio Rogmann / Serge Shumilov

2

What Services does the GeoPortal provide?

Based on internationally approved standards the GeoPortal provides a variety of services: Catalogue Services

• •

Searching Browsing

and

filtering

of available datasets on the attribute level through a comprehensive data catalog and thematic maps

Portrayal Services Portal Services

Interactive mapping

• Tools for services for cartographic representation of spatially referenced data

visual exploration

and

analysis

of data • •

Download

of selected data (metadata)

Interactive means

for creating, upload and managing of data (metadata) resources

Administrative Services

• •

Users administration and security facilities Meetings planer

and

notifications

to enable communication and exchange of geoscientific information within defined groups

Antonio Rogmann / Serge Shumilov

3

Main Characteristics of the Geoportal Architecture

Expandable set of exchangeable active components (Java/JSP) for visualization, downloading and management of data ISO-compatible data catalog based on the Dublin Core metadata standard ensures compatibility with other catalogs Portal interfaces based on the specifications issued by the Open Geospatial Consortium (OGC) ensure that the portal and the data catalog can communicate with other catalogs and clients Virtualization of the web server improves portability of the Geoportal and significantly simplifies its installation The use of open source software based ensures cost-efficiency ESRI Arc Engine is a sole commercial software needed to access ESRI databases

Antonio Rogmann / Serge Shumilov

4

Component-based Geoportal Architecture

Geoportal architecture consists of several components providing particular portal's functionalities.

Data server (Linux) Virtual Machine (VMware) Web server (Windows) Apache Web server / Tomcat Geoportal DataManagers Search JSP/Java Viewers MapViewer GoogleMapViewer DataManager MetadataManager DataViewer Organizer UserManager ContentManager Downloaders DataDownloader MapDownloader JDBC / SMB NFS Geoportal DB Data catalog Data storage File system ESRI DB ESRI DB … ESRI ArcGIS Engine Runtime ESRI DB Antonio Rogmann / Serge Shumilov

5

The GLOWA Volta Geoportal

Data search

 

find and assess download

Interactive geodata

 

compose, view and analyze on map download from map

Antonio Rogmann / Serge Shumilov

Publish and share data

  

index and administrate assign use rights upload for distribution

6

User and Operations in the Geoportal

The range of operations provided by the Geoportal is determined by the assignment of the user to a functional group

The goal is to warrant a coordinated web-based access for indexing, up- and downloading of data and management of the system ... ... with focus on the protection of owner rights of the resources hosted by the Geoportal!!

Antonio Rogmann / Serge Shumilov

7

User and Operations in the Geoportal

„Consumer“ – Level

Guest

► ►

(registered as “all” in the user database) search in meta data catalog visualize map based geodata with Map Viewer

► ►

download data in public domain don’t need to be registered personally in the Geoportal

Member of a specified user group (e.g. an institutional group)

same operation as the “guest”-user

download of data with access rights only for his user group

needs to have an user account in the Geoportal

8

Antonio Rogmann / Serge Shumilov

User and Operations in the Geoportal

„Contributor“ – Level

Meta Data-Uploader

enter, delete and upgrade of your own meta data sets

determine which user groups are allowed to access their data indexed in the catalog

„Administrator“ – Level

Meta Data-Administrator

control, edit, delete and approve of all meta data sets

Geoportal-Administrator

administrate user database and content of Geoportal Antonio Rogmann / Serge Shumilov

9

Meta Data in the Catalogue-System

The data are indexed in a catalogue consisting of a range of meta data elements

This meta data elements provide detailed information, usable to assess if the resources are applicable for the own requirements of data processing and information

The GLOWA Volta Geoportal offers several ways to find data and other resources (documents, maps, applications) in the GLOWA Volta datastock by using the catalogue service ...

10

Antonio Rogmann / Serge Shumilov

Search for Data and Documents

Approaches to find data and documents by „search in meta data“

Keyword-based search in all catalog elements. Filtering by „AND“ search relation Selection for geodata embedded in Web Map Services only Search in predefined subject / topic list Antonio Rogmann / Serge Shumilov

11

Search for Data and Documents

Approaches to find data and documents by „advanced search ...“

Combination of different criteria frequently used Advanced search to find data by criteria based on selected catalog elements Antonio Rogmann / Serge Shumilov

12

Search for Data and Documents

More approaches to find data, documents (and maps)

Antonio Rogmann / Serge Shumilov

13

Search Results in Data Viewer

Short List Detailed Description Meta data sets which seem to be interesting can be reviewed in a detailed description within the data viewer Basic information needed to assess the data in relation to its usability is provided in the long version of the meta data set Scroll through a result shortlist Antonio Rogmann / Serge Shumilov

14

Search Data by Relations in Meta Data Set

Topical relationships between resources (raw-data

can be browsed through meta data sets processed data)

Uniform Resource Name (identifier) acts as link to related data set Meta data set can be downloaded as text file Antonio Rogmann / Serge Shumilov

15

Data Download

By obtaining the proper access rights, data can be downloaded directly from the catalog search result

Delivered as compressed file (.zip) Download button Permanent link can be copied and used e.g. in favourite lists

16

Antonio Rogmann / Serge Shumilov

Protection against unallowed Download

The major part of data in the GLOWA Volta datastock is protected by owner rights

To access protected data, the user has to have an user account in the Geoportal

The data of interest needs to be assigned in the meta data set to the user-group of which the user is a member

To get a membership, the Geoportal administrator has to be contacted by the user (by email)

Administration tool to generate user accounts and ...

... for user group management Antonio Rogmann / Serge Shumilov

17

Visualization of Geo-Scientific Data on Interactive Maps

Geo-scientific data are stored in different formats with different behavior in the Geoportal

 Single raster and vector files  Relational geodatabases   Map Projects (mainly ESRI ArcView and ArcGIS format)

Meta data editor with elements to describe Web Map Services geo-data properties

Web Map Service (WMS) displays spatial data

 in its cartographic context  interactively by providing fundamental GIS functionalities  as raster images separated from the (protected) original geo data  using a common internet browser 

WMS: specified by the Open Geospatial Consortium (OGC)

 supported by a broad range of GIS-clients (ArcGIS, GRASS, Open Jump, ...)  interoperable with other, distributed Open GIS-services: WMS, Web Feature Service (WFS), Web Coverage Service (WCS), ....

Antonio Rogmann / Serge Shumilov

18

Types of Interactive Maps

The Geoportal provides two kinds of interactive maps as Web Map Services

Single WMS layers

searchable in the catalog and to be combined in one map viewer interface by the map basket

mainly used to

assess geodata in order to download and process locally

analyze spatial relationships for decision support One thematic layer (popu lation) and one basic layer (basin border)

Population Density 2000 in theVolta Basin 

Project maps

composed of several layers with specific symbolization

mainly aimed to inform about GLOWA Volta Project research Several the matic layers in specific scientific context

Volta Basin Water Allocation System (VB-WAS)

Antonio Rogmann / Serge Shumilov

19

Access Interactive Maps with Map Basket

The Map Basket is a service to combine several WMS in one Map Viewer interface

Search only WMS Add WMS of interest to the map basket Result List Selectable layers for download. If required, together with the map project file (.mxd) Direct download is yet possible Antonio Rogmann / Serge Shumilov Content of map basket

20

Organize the Map with Map Viewer

The map viewer is a cartographic interface in a web-browser

Manipulation of layer visibility and display range on map Legend corresponds with visible layers WMS link to copy for using the WMS in another WMS client like ArcGIS Three WMS Antonio Rogmann / Serge Shumilov

21

Gain Information with Map Viewer

Example: NDVI is composed with climate stations (linked with rainfall time series)

Info button activation followed by mouse-click on map-object provides object related information Additional information: link to meta data set in order to get detailed information about the station Compare 1. WMS: mean annual NDVI with 2. WMS: mean yearly rainfall Additional information: Further available climate parameters collected by climate station Antonio Rogmann / Serge Shumilov

22

Download Data with Map Viewer

WMS only displays interactive images of maps. Usable data are to be downloaded – if allowed for the user

Layer of interest can be selected Antonio Rogmann / Serge Shumilov

23

Contribution of Meta Information to the Geoportal

Data about data (meta data set = catalog entry) describes data and resources - independently of the data storage location

Web-Services (e.g. for data download) offered by other institutions can be linked within a meta data set

Lacking web based facilities for data distribution: “contact” information leads on the way to get data

Offline (in the field) created catalog entries can be uploaded Meta data uploader gets the meta data upload tool Delete and edit own catalog entries Add new catalog entry Antonio Rogmann / Serge Shumilov

24

Edit Meta Data with Meta Data Interface

Uniform Resource Name Generator (URN) gives each dataset described in the catalogue an unique identifier

URN syntax reflects properties of the described resource Uniform Resource Name is automatically generated

Unique identifiers avoid redundancies and confusion in the datastock

Antonio Rogmann / Serge Shumilov

25

Edit Meta Data with Meta Data Interface

The Editor provides an easy to use interface with about 25 element fields

Fill in of all elements is not mandatory

Range of elements can be extended flexibly if needed

Quality of entries controlled by Meta Data Administrator

Assignement of users or user-groups allowed to gather the dataset. Only needed if dataset is stored in the Geoportal data bases ready for download Antonio Rogmann / Serge Shumilov

26

Integration of Data into the Geoportal

Data indexed in the Geoportal Catalog can be located

 

outside or inside of the central database hosted by GLOWA Volta (or another hosting institution) Advantage to store distributive data on the central data server: use of Geoportal Services to share data via web

Integration of own datasets into the central database needs …

… a registration to get the necessary meta data upload and administration rights (contact the Geoportal administrator)

… the consideration of certain standards in regard to the preparing of data which is going to be shared Antonio Rogmann / Serge Shumilov

27

Data Management Standards

Standards in data quality (control), naming conventions and exchange formats improve the use and processing of data

To inform about the level of data quality just gives the data quality!

Meta data element Quality control

Significant file naming simplifies the organization of data files (e.g. after download on the local machine)

glowa_hyd_discharge_arli-dou-burkinafaso_1978-1987_monthly.csv

Project Scientific discipline and topic Antonio Rogmann / Serge Shumilov Spatial coverage Time frame

28

Data Management Standards

GLOWA Volta Data Management Workflow describes steps in data handling and transfer

Step 2: identify the data by assigning an URN and/or name Data management step icons are linked with explaining documents

Workflow will be published as web page close to the Geoportal!

Antonio Rogmann / Serge Shumilov

29

Integration of Data into the Geoportal

Upload of data sets, documents and other resources to the central database

Server Area Local Area Data upload as next step after meta data upload This was shown before Antonio Rogmann / Serge Shumilov

30

Integration of Data into the Geoportal Infrastructure

Data transfer at the Center for Development Research (ZEF)

Integration Distribution

Coordinated data integration and distribution

Administrator controlls integration

ZEF-Inhouse Local Data ZEF Member Extern External User Registration and login data transmission Intranet Geoportal SSH

Only quality controlled data meeting the standards is transferred into the central data bases – ready for distribution

Antonio Rogmann / Serge Shumilov Shared Data Open Area ZEF-Data-Server Meta DB Secure Area Central Uploaded Administrator Data base Data restores new uploaded data Transfer Area Admin

31